Justin Bond is one of the most exciting and spellbinding contemporary Cabaret performers, working internationally today. Mx. Bond’s storytelling is engrossing, endearing and witty. I am so delighted to be bringing Justin Bond back to Seattle to open my third season “ The Gilded Stage” at The Triple Door.

Last year Justin performed “The Rites of Spring- More Songs for The Neo Pagan Revolution” which included the songs from his solo debut album “Pink Slip” (a quadruple entendre!) that was released last April. The show concluded after three standin g ovations and encores. You should all buy it! (The album) or download it on itunes! What does Justin have in store for us this year?

On March 18- Justin will be performing “Angels of The Morning – The Ladies of AM Radio”. “Slip into your STRING BIKINI and turn on your TRANS/SISTER radio and say hello to SUNNY SKIES with Justin Bond and The Ladies of top 40 AM. Picture yourself POOLSIDE in the early 1970’s slathered in COPPER TONE. The sun is Killing You Softly as you sip a PINA COLADA and breathe in the AFTERNOON DELIGHT. Justin promises to Light Up Your Life with a bevy of special guests! WERQUE!!!” – Justin Bond

Justin will be backed by Seattle’s own Kurt Bloch on guitar, Mark Pickerel on Drums and Jim Sangster on Bass.
